Title :
An Efficient Control Signal Generation Scheme for QKD System

Abstract :
In a QKD system, it is essential to generate many types of control signals to guarantee the proper operations of all physical devices. Although many practical QKD systems have been developed, the control signal generation scheme has not been studied thoroughly enough. In this paper, an efficient control signal generation scheme based on FPGA is proposed. Our scheme has the advantages of high precision, large adjusting range and high reliability. Both the analysis and experimental results verify the feasibility and high performance of the scheme.
